Understanding the Types of Rock Crusher Machines

Rock crusher machines are indispensable tools in the construction and mining industries, designed to reduce the size of large rocks into manageable pieces or fine powders. There are several types of rock crushers, each tailored to a specific application and material type. Primary crushers, such as jaw crushers, are used to reduce large materials into smaller pieces suitable for secondary crushing. Secondary crushers, like cone crushers and impact crushers, further reduce the size of the material. Each type of crusher is built with a particular purpose in mind, whether it’s for initial material size reduction or for producing finely crushed materials intended for use in construction or manufacturing.

Evaluating the Performance Metrics of Rock Crushers

Evaluating the effectiveness of rock crusher machines involves analyzing several performance metrics. These include throughput capacity, which measures the amount of material processed over a given time period, and reduction ratio, indicating how effectively the crusher reduces the size of the input material. Crushing efficiency is another critical metric, reflecting the proportion of energy converted into useful work versus energy lost as heat, noise, and vibration. Durability and maintenance requirements also play a significant role in performance, with robust machines requiring fewer repairs and ensuring prolonged operation with minimal downtime.

Comparative Analysis: Traditional vs. Modern Rock Crusher Technologies

Traditional rock crusher technologies relied heavily on manual adjustments and lacked automated controls, making them less efficient and more labor-intensive. These machines often produced inconsistent material sizes and required frequent maintenance. Despite being durable, traditional crushers were not as energy-efficient and generated higher operational costs in the long run. Additionally, safety standards have evolved, making older machinery less compliant with modern requirements.
